Q&A

  • 오라클에서 Unknow error Network 에러 답변입니다.
안녕하세요 광주에 사는 반칙왕입니다.



초보중에 초보인 제가 글을 올리다니 지송^^



그 에러는 오라클 서버와의 연결이 안되었을때 나타나는 현상입니다.

첫째, 그 서버로 Ping 테스트를 해보고, 연결이 되었다면 1차는 성공입니다.



그런데도 그 에러가 났다면



둘째. 방화벽이 있는지를 의심을 해봐야 겠습니다.

방화벽은 원래 IP Address 와 사용되는 Port Number를 통해서 통제를 하

는 것으로 알고 있습니다. 예를 들어서 텔렛을 막을려고 하면

해당 IP Address 에 23번 Port Number를 막아놓으면 23번 통로가 막혀있으니

연결이 안되겠죠?

(참고로 오라클은 1521번 포트를 씁니다.)

혹시 사용하시는 곳의 전산 담당자에게 문의 하셔서 방화벽이

있다면 1521번을 열어달라고 하십시요....



그래도 연결이 안된다.. 네트워크도 아니고, 방화벽도 아니고 그럼



셋째, 맞다.. 알리아스를 확인해보세요 오라클은 test라는 알리아스를 사용하신다면

test.world라는 알리아스를 생성해주어야 합니다.



Oracle Net8 Easy Config 라는 메뉴가 있는데 여기에 들어가시면

new로 접속하여 test.world라고 만들어서 테스트를 하면 됩니다.



넷째, Dos창에서 c:>autoexec.bat를 확인 해 보세요

Oracle이 설정이 끝나면 path를 자동으로 수정하는데 바보같이 공백이나

기타 여러가지 문제로 안되는 경우가 있습니다.

Path 줄을 지우고 수동으로 직접 기재를 하십시요

그리고 c:orawin95;를 추가하면 분명히 되리라고 생각합니다.

재 부팅은 필수 입니다.

테스트는 아무 디렉토리에서나 c:orawin95에 있는 파일 실행해서

찾을수 없다는 메세지가 나오면 path를 다시 확인하십시요



다섯째, BDE 셋팅에서 configration 항목에 drivers 의 nativ 를 선택하면

oracle이 나옵니다. 여기서 vender init를 oci.dll 그리고

DLL32 에서 sqlora32를 선택합니다. 그럼 아마 그 오라클의 버젼 문제도

해결이 될것으로 기대됩니다.



잘모르는 초보가 주제 넘게 글을
0  COMMENTS